Hitting debug will deploy the application to \program files\AppNamespace\AppName.exe and attach to it. However, my app runs on the storage card \SD-MMC Card.
This means I’m debugging and running in different places, so I have a slight maintenance headache.
Therefore the question is, anyone know if you can specify the folder VS will use when debugging?
Why are you debugging from \program files\AppNamespace\AppName.exe then? Debug from the actual target location.
Project Properties->Devices->Output File Folder
Set that to ‘Location’ = ‘Root Folder’ and ‘Subdirectory’ to ‘\SD-MMC Card’.
